Output 541955615007e4d64cdd4dc79c90f9434392392d21db1e3b0c20f98b601a4f32:0

value
399873633
script pubkey
OP_0 OP_PUSHBYTES_20 51b4bcfc9946d6764e48bc9a09cf7851e95ae5e8
address
bc1q2x6telyegmt8vnjghjdqnnmc28544e0gk47n2y
transaction
541955615007e4d64cdd4dc79c90f9434392392d21db1e3b0c20f98b601a4f32
confirmations
382060
spent
true